Returning Customer ?
Don't have an account ?
No products in the cart.
Showing 346–360 of 723 results
pr-4535123841965
till qty are full/Arrival Est. Apr. 2025
pr-4535123841989
till qty are full/Arrival Est. May. 2025
pr-4535123841729
till qty are full/Arrival Est. Feb. 2025
pr-4535123839375
Deadline Jun-21-2024/Arrival Est. Nov. 2024
pr-4535123839382
pr-4535123841972
Deadline Oct-25-2024/Arrival Est. Apr. 2025
pr-4535123841736
pr-4535123841712
pr-4535123833397
till qty are full / Estimated Arrival Feb 2023
pr-4535123842290
till qty are full/Arrival Est. Jun. 2025
pr-4535123842306
pr-4535123842283
pr-4535123843228
till qty are full/Arrival Est. Jul. 2025
pr-4535123839368
till qty are full/Arrival Est. Oct. 2024
pr-4535123839344